Access Denied

You don't have permission to access "http://www.tripadvisor.com.hk/ShowUserReviews-g13806804-d15779342-r729164683-Xian_Yue_Ju-Puzi_Chiayi_County.html" on this server.

Reference #18.53b03b17.1713457341.272f3fe9

https://errors.edgesuite.net/18.53b03b17.1713457341.272f3fe9